Alpinoplagia
Scientific classification Edit this classification
Domain: Eukaryota
Kingdom: Animalia
Phylum: Arthropoda
Class: Insecta
Order: Diptera
Family: Tachinidae
Subfamily: Dexiinae
Tribe: Voriini
Genus: Alpinoplagia
Townsend, 1931[1]
Type species
Alpinoplagia boliviana

Alpinoplagia is a genus of parasitic flies in the family Tachinidae.[2]

Species

Distribution

Bolivia, Chile.
